When users access Vena directly from Excel, everything works fine. However, as soon as they try to open files from Business Central in Excel (e.g., by downloading and opening them), we encounter the error shown below.

We have integrated Vena through Microsoft 365, and when checking under:

admin.microsoft.com

Navigate to Show All > Settings > Integrated Apps

 

it shows that the Vena app is installed and running correctly (green status). We've also ensured that users are added to the appropriate group we created in our Azure environment.

 

Despite everything working fine within Excel itself, the integration fails when accessing Excel files via Business Central through the web. Could you please assist us in resolving this? 😊

    It seems like the issue lies in the integration between Business Central and Vena when accessing Excel files through the web. Here are some steps and suggestions to troubleshoot and resolve the problem:
     
    1. Verify Excel Add-In Configuration: Ensure that the Microsoft Dynamics Excel Add-In is correctly installed and configured. Sometimes, issues arise if the add-in is not properly set up or enabled for Business Central.
    2. Check User Permissions: Double-check that all users have the necessary permissions in both Business Central and Azure Active Directory (AAD). Ensure that the group created in Azure has the correct roles assigned for accessing integrated apps.
    3. Browser Compatibility: Test the functionality in different web browsers to rule out browser-specific issues. Clear the browser cache and ensure that pop-ups are not being blocked.
    4. Excel File Format: Confirm that the files being downloaded from Business Central are in a compatible format for Vena. If there are any discrepancies in the file format, it could cause integration issues.
    5. Update Business Central and Vena: Ensure that both Business Central and Vena are updated to their latest versions. Compatibility issues can sometimes arise from outdated software.
    6. Network and Firewall Settings: Check if there are any network or firewall restrictions that might be blocking the connection between Business Central and Vena when accessing files through the web.
    7. Contact Vena Support: If the issue persists, reaching out to Vena Customer Support might provide additional insights or solutions specific to their integration with Business Central.

    Try using the browser version first:
    Dynamics 365 Business Central: How to use Edit in Excel in the browser/web (Excel Online)
     
    If this also cannot solve the problem, it may be that the format of the exported Excel version is different from the standard one, and you need to consult Microsoft to find out.
